Finance Review Summary — Closure of the Dovel Street Office

Sales leads: the Dovel Street office closes at the end of Q3. Seven staff relocate to the Marwick hub; two roles are made remote. Lease break fee is covered by the existing facilities reserve. Annualised savings estimated at 310K. Client meetings previously hosted on site shift to the Marwick suites; book early, capacity is tight. Territory coverage is unchanged. Escalate any client concerns through regional managers. The confidential note below outlines the related business plans.

management briefing: Headcount on the Holdor team goes from 20 to 123 by the end of June. Gross margin on Holdor came in at 13 percent against a plan of 32 percent.

# Environments — ReceiptRelay

ReceiptRelay (donation-receipt mailer) runs three environments: dev, staging, prod. Dev uses a mail sink; nothing leaves the cluster. Staging sends only to an internal allowlist. Prod sends real mail and signs receipts. Secrets are injected at deploy time; nothing is baked into images. Staging and prod differ only in sender domain, rate limits, and signing mode. Rotation cadence: quarterly. For review purposes, the effective configuration of the staging environment is reproduced below.

settings of tagef-bawif:
DRUIX_HOST=druix.zemvarlabs.internal
DRUIX_PORT=8000

**Runbook: Chalkline Solver restarts**

Quick note for the sync — if the Chalkline timetable solver wedges during the Monday batch, don't just kill the pod. Drain the constraint queue first, then restart, otherwise half-solved timetables get committed and the Brindlewick pilot schools see broken schedules. Takes maybe two minutes. If it wedges twice in a row, page whoever owns the solver rotation. Check the token below before escalating, since it identifies the exact solver build.

session token of tajef-bageg = htk21_5d90d574934f3ccae6437

# Sessions in SnackPlan

Quick version: every support lookup in SnackPlan rides on a session that times out after 20 minutes idle. If a customer's restock route won't load, nine times out of ten the session expired — just re-auth and retry. When testing against staging yourselves, authenticate your calls with the shared support token below.

portal login ticket: eyJhbGciOiJIUzI1NiIsInR5cCI6IkpXVCJ9.eyJzdWIiOiIwEOsktwVNwIn0.-UJU3fdyyCgG